Title 198 - RULES AND REGULATIONS PERTAINING TO AGRICULTURAL CHEMICAL CONTAINMENT
Chapter 4 - SECONDARY CONTAINMENT FACILITY, LOADOUT FACILITY; LOCATION
Section 198-4-005

Current through March 20, 2024

Underground storage of bulk liquid pesticide and bulk fertilizer is prohibited. Temporary underground containment of pesticide or fertilizer rinsed or washed off material, runoff, or other accumulations is allowed under the following conditions:

005.01 A sump open to visual inspection; or

005.02 A container situated in a concrete or solid masonry lined vault open to visual inspection. The container is to be on or above the surface of the floor such that any leak from the container or appurtenances may be readily detected.
